Technology-Driven Moisture Management

Smart waterproofing systems represent the convergence of advanced engineering and intuitive user experience. Automated sump pumps operate silently, monitoring water levels and adjusting operation seamlessly without requiring user intervention. These systems integrate with home automation platforms, providing status updates and maintenance alerts through smartphone applications rather than intrusive alarm systems.

Environmental sensors create comprehensive moisture management ecosystems that respond automatically to changing conditions. Humidity levels trigger ventilation adjustments, while temperature variations activate heating elements that prevent condensation. This sophisticated monitoring eliminates the guesswork from basement climate control while maintaining optimal conditions for both structural protection and comfortable habitation.

The integration extends to predictive maintenance capabilities that notify homeowners of required service before problems develop. This proactive approach prevents emergency situations while ensuring continuous protection, allowing families to enjoy their basement spaces with complete confidence in system reliability.

Aesthetic Considerations for Contemporary Spaces

Modern waterproofing installations prioritize visual integration as highly as functional performance. Access panels feature premium materials and precise manufacturing that match surrounding finishes exactly. Control interfaces adopt the clean, intuitive design languages found in luxury appliances and smart home devices.

Color coordination receives careful attention in contemporary installations. System components integrate harmoniously with chosen color palettes, while finish materials complement rather than compete with interior design elements. This thoughtful approach ensures waterproofing enhances rather than compromises overall aesthetic goals.

Lighting integration offers additional opportunities for design enhancement. LED accent lighting within drainage channels creates subtle visual interest while providing practical illumination for maintenance access. These details transform utilitarian elements into design features that contribute to the sophisticated ambiance modern homeowners seek.
